* * PRICED TO SELL! * * Experience timeless elegance and modern comfort in this stunning historic home originally from the late 1800s nestled on an acre in a quiet setting. Natural light pours through the wood windows, highlighting the charm of wood accents, tall ceilings, and detailed crown molding. The heart of the home is the beautifully designed kitchen featuring a gas stove, farmhouse sink, granite countertops, tile backsplash, built-in desk area, walk-in pantry, and a reclaimed wood ceiling with exposed beam. The formal dining room is a showstopper with French doors, transoms, and plenty of space for entertaining. A grand staircase with chandelier sets the tone upon entry, while the front bedroom with faux mantle offers the perfect space for an office. The downstairs secondary bath includes a pedestal sink and classic clawfoot tub. The expansive master suite offers dual antique vanities, a large walk-in shower, and generous closet space. With three bedrooms downstairs and an additional upstairs retreat featuring a huge bedroom with Ensuite bath and an oversized game room, there is space for everyone. Throughout the home you’ll find rich wood floors, no carpet, and historic details blended with thoughtful updates. Relax on the Southern-style front porch with gas lanterns and swing, or take in peaceful views of horses from the back windows. A covered carport adds convenience. The home is just minutes from Dutchtown schools, restaurants and I-10. Rest assured, this home has a 1 year old roof and was remodeled in 2009. RM
Medium Intensity Residential District
This district is designated for single-family residential development. This district exists largely outside the 100-year floodplain and in the northern part of the parish.
Permitted uses
Include but are not limited to:
Agriculture
Livestock production
Religious facility
Housing-Group
Housing-Single unit
Infrastructure
Educational/school
Post office
Recreation
Cemetery
